The Abundant Life

Friends, Christian should have a peaceful, success and satisfied life. But we find, many Christians, even Church leaders do not have such coveted life. Why? Why don’t we have such blessed life? There must be something we lag behind, let us consider the matter.
We know that by believing God and accepting Jesus Christ as Lord and Saviour, God has given us ‘eternal life’, as the Bible says, “everyone who believes ( in Jesus Christ ) may have eternal life in him.” (John 3:15).  
But there is more than just to have ‘eternal life’. Jesus said “ . . ….. I came that they might have life, and might have it abundantly” (John 10:10).
Thus, we understand that all believers have life, but not all have abundant life. To have ‘eternal life’ is one thing and to have ‘abundant life’ is more than that. Jesus Christ came that we might have life abundantly. If we don’t have this abundant life, we will not be able to live a good Christian, spiritual life. Jesus, therefore, wants to give us this abundant life, so that we may be like Him. Without it, the Christian life becomes inane and meaningless.
To have abundant life, we must have abundant resources, and the only unlimited source of life is in the Person of Jesus Christ, the Son of God. So, Jesus says, “Jesus answered, “I am the way and the truth and the life. No one comes to the Father except through me.”  (John 14:6).

GOSPEL IS FOR ALL

No one preach ‘Gospel’ by force, all are telling others the Love of God reveal in Jesus Christ. None is force to respond. But all who enjoy the love of God in Jesus Christ are commanded to tell others that they may receive and enjoy the Love of God with all the blessings.
What God said to our Lord Jesus Christ is written in Isaiah 49:6 – “He says: “It is too small a thing for You (Jesus) to be my servant to restore the tribes of Jacobs and bring back those of Israel I have kept. I will also make You a light ( to give the message of God’s Love for all) for the Gentiles (all tribes other than Israel) that You may bring salvation to the ends of the earth(all people living on earth).” (Isaiah 49:6)
Therefore, Jesus came to the world and after teaching the Good News of Salvation of God through Him, He died on the cross as a sacrifices for all that all who believe in Him (Jesus) and accept Him as Lord and Saviour (no longer make sacrifices to please God as Jesus has sacrificed His life once for all for who believes in Him), have everlasting life with God. This is called Gospel.

LOVING OTHERS

God created man to have close relationship with Him. God created woman (Eve) to be a helper and companion of man (Adam). Genesis chapter 2 says that after God had created Adam,He created Eve to be his helper, read : “ The Lord God said, “It is not good for the man to be alone. I will make a helper suitable for him.” (Genesis 2:18)  “ Then the Lord God made a woman from the rib he had taken out of the man, and he brought her to the man.” (Genesis 2:22)’
Therefore, God’s design is that we must have relationship with Him and also have relationship with other human beings as friends, family, co-workers, neighbours and so on.
Jesus tells us that our first duty is to love our Creator God and love others as well saying 
 ”‘Love the Lord your God with all your heart and with all your soul and with all your mind.’  This is the first and greatest commandment.  And the second is like it: ‘Love your neighbor as yourself.’ All the Law and the Prophets hang on these two commandments.” (Matthew 22:37-39).
